[发明专利]一种gis数据处理及渲染方法有效
申请号: | 202210503626.9 | 申请日: | 2022-05-10 |
公开(公告)号: | CN114611036B | 公开(公告)日: | 2022-10-21 |
发明(设计)人: | 王瑾;罗喜伶;马佳曼;王景林 | 申请(专利权)人: | 北京航空航天大学杭州创新研究院 |
主分类号: | G06F16/957 | 分类号: | G06F16/957;G06F16/9532;G06F16/9537 |
代理公司: | 杭州求是专利事务所有限公司 33200 | 代理人: | 郑海峰 |
地址: | 310051 浙江省*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 gis 数据处理 渲染 方法 | ||
本发明提供了一种gis数据处理及渲染方法,属于webgis领域。本发明根据地理底图的切片方案结合应用需求以及浏览效果寻找最优比例阈值,通过最优比例阈值将把目标地图数据分为两层,上层仅作为基础底图用于浏览,下层用于进行要素查询以及交互;根据比例阈值对目标地图数据制定切图方案进行切图,通过geoserver发布成wmts服务,同时发布wfs服务。客户端监听地图缩放事件,当地图缩放小于比例阈值时,采用wmts服务加载展示,反之当地图缩放大于比例阈值的时候,移除wmts服务,加载wfs服务显示。本发明通过动态加载和按需加载方式,兼顾渲染速度的同时满足了地图要素的查询功能,提高了渲染速度,为webgis可视化特殊业务场景下提供了一种新的数据处理的解决思路。
技术领域
本发明属于webgis领域,具体涉及一种gis数据处理以及渲染方法。
背景技术
随着webgis技术的发展,基于gis数据的可视化研究已经取到了一定成功,随着各行各样矢量数据的增多,不同的应用中都开始进行海量数据的渲染呈现,再进行复杂矢量数据的地图绘制中,数据渲染的速度是决定网页速度的一个重要指标。海量gis数据在很多业务场景中,不单单是作为地理底图显示存在,很多需求场景下在小比例尺下需要支持细节要素的信息展示。
目前,客户端提高gis数据渲染方法主要分为以下几类:
(1)数据抽稀处理
针对gis数据进行抽稀处理,如将地图中多条道路的几何形状进行合并,减少非重要的点数据等,该方法虽然能提高渲染速度,但在此过程中减少了原本应该出现的地物,真实性不够。
(2)数据切片
将gis数据切片处理,客户端统一采用瓦片渲染,该方法依据特定的二维空间分层网格切分方案,在服务端预先生成了栅格瓦片金字塔,客户端在地图浏览时根据视口范围从服务端获取对应的瓦片,最终拼接成完整的地图,由于是预先成图,所以速度很快。该方法主要缺点为1)服务器同时承担数据检索和图形渲染任务,负载较大。2)存储空间问题,一些导航终端或者嵌入设备仅能存储少量数据,不足以存放大量数据3)由于web端获取的都是静态图片,针对细节要素,没办法实现要素闪烁、高亮、查询信息等交互功能。
(3)数据聚合
数据聚合是采用不同的算法,在用户有限的可视区域范围内,利用最小的区域展示最全面的信息,又不产生重叠覆盖。以网格距离法为例,将地理范围划分成指定尺寸的正方形(每个缩放级别不同尺寸),求解各个网格的质心,判断各个质心是否在某个范围内,如果在某个范围内,就将质心合并。该方法虽然能够提高渲染速度,但是不能直观表示所有数据点的位置,并且只局限于点图层。
现有的方法在提高gis数据渲染时有利有弊,渲染时无法兼顾准确性和高效性,较少考虑查询交互问题等,因此,在既能满足用户查询功能,又能准确和高效性这种应用场景下,提出一种gis数据处理及渲染方法是有必要且重要的。
发明内容
本发明的目的在于克服现有技术的不足,解决海量数据在web端高效渲染的情况下,同时满足查询功能的问题,提供了一种该应用场景下gis数据处理和渲染方法。
为实现上述目的,本发明提供技术方案如下:
本发明首先提供了一种gis数据处理及渲染方法,其包括如下步骤:
1)获取地理底图及目标地图数据,采用 geoserver发布wfs服务;根据地理底图的切片方案,寻找最优比例阈值,通过最优比例阈值将目标地图数据分为两层,最上面一层仅作为基础底图用于进行浏览,下面一层用于进行详细要素查询以及交互;
2)以设定的最优比例阈值作参考,参考地理底图切片方案制定切片策略进行切图,发布wmts服务;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京航空航天大学杭州创新研究院,未经北京航空航天大学杭州创新研究院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210503626.9/2.html,转载请声明来源钻瓜专利网。